HID: bpf: drop use of Logical|Physical|UsageRange
authorBenjamin Tissoires <bentiss@kernel.org>
Thu, 17 Oct 2024 16:35:00 +0000 (18:35 +0200)
committerBenjamin Tissoires <bentiss@kernel.org>
Fri, 18 Oct 2024 12:37:33 +0000 (14:37 +0200)
commitb6d8c474e26517f944208e4645a2a09a6eeee88e
tree408262db30ef45de44c8ae8d2783301426448ace
parentcee9faff2f65d00fe8a56c1223c9c52435eb525d
HID: bpf: drop use of Logical|Physical|UsageRange

Replace with individual Minimum/Maximum calls to match the HID report
descriptor - HID doesn't have a Range field. Abstracting this is good
for hand-written descriptors but almost all tools will output min/max
instead so let's stick with that.

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
Acked-by: Jiri Kosina <jkosina@suse.com>
Link: https://patch.msgid.link/20241017-import_bpf_6-13-v2-3-6a7acb89a97f@kernel.org
Signed-off-by: Benjamin Tissoires <bentiss@kernel.org>
drivers/hid/bpf/progs/Huion__Dial-2.bpf.c
drivers/hid/bpf/progs/Huion__Inspiroy-2-S.bpf.c
drivers/hid/bpf/progs/hid_report_helpers.h